Oenops - Aplá dry rosé wine 2019 (88 TSW)
Greece Blend of 50% Xinomavro – 30% Limniona – 20% Mavroudi.
Direct pressing after sorting of the grapes (some lots whole cluster)
Fermentation in inox and concrete tanks, independently for each parcel.
Four months aging on the fine lees before bottling.
My tasting notes:
In the glass a bright copper - orange color.
On the medium nose aromas of orangezest, strawberries and watermelon with hints of nectarine, jasmine and tomatoleafs.
On the palate dry, medium bodied with medium acidity and nice freshness. Flavours of lemon, nectarine, flowers, pear and apricot. Medium(+) length finish with peach and watermelon notes.
Food matching: Serve as a great match for pasta, pizza, fish, salads, fruits, cheese. A perfect accompaniment to Mediterranean and Greek dishes, yet it may be served as aperitif on its own.
Nikos Karatzas founded OENOPS WINES PC in 2015 and it is the most newly established winery in the region of Drama. Its main purpose is to produce high quality wines in limited quantities. The grapes come from personally selected vineyards from Drama and Macedonia in general, that are cultivated from ambitious winegrowers.
